The power tower, also called a roman chair, is one of the highest-value square metres on a strength floor. A single vertical frame delivers pull-ups, dips, leg raises and push-up work, it needs no weight stack, and it is used by members who would never touch a selectorised machine. This guide is for facility operators: what the station trains, how the single and multi-function versions differ, where each belongs, and what a professional unit actually costs.
What a power tower is
A power tower is a self-supporting steel frame built for bodyweight training. It carries a pull-up bar at the top, parallel dip handles at mid height, and usually a back pad with forearm supports for hanging or supported leg raises. Some models add push-up handles at floor level and anchor points for resistance bands.
There is no weight stack and no linkage. Resistance is the user’s own bodyweight, adjusted by adding a weight belt or by changing the leverage of the movement. That simplicity is exactly what makes the station valuable in a commercial setting: nothing to select, nothing to reset, and very little to go wrong.
Single-function and multi-function models
Single-function towers
The basic configuration is a robust frame with a pull-up bar and dip handles. It covers the two movements that most members cannot get anywhere else on the floor, it takes up very little space, and it is the right answer for a hotel fitness room, a residential gym or a compact studio where a single station has to do a lot of work.
Multi-function towers
Multi-function units add a vertical knee-raise station, push-up handles, band anchor points and, on some models, additional grip positions on the pull-up bar. They suit clubs and cross-training facilities where several members use the frame in rotation and where programming genuinely varies from session to session.

What the station trains
- Pull-ups and chin-ups. Latissimus dorsi and the rest of the back musculature, with substantial biceps and grip involvement. Grip position changes the emphasis.
- Dips. Triceps and the sternal fibres of the pectoralis major, with the anterior deltoid contributing. Torso lean shifts the balance between chest and triceps.
- Hanging and supported leg raises. The abdominal wall and the hip flexors, with grip and shoulder position loaded throughout on the hanging version.
- Push-up variations. Horizontal pressing at a load the member can manage, useful as an entry point and as a finisher.
None of these require an instructor to set up, which is a real operational advantage at hours when floor coverage is thin.
Coaching the movements
- Pull-ups. Start from a controlled hang rather than a swing. The trunk stays braced, the shoulders set, and the movement stops where the member can still control the descent.
- Dips. Lower until the elbows reach roughly a right angle, then press back up under control. Going deeper than the shoulder can hold position is where dip injuries come from.
- Leg raises. The abdominal wall does the work. A member who swings from the hips is training momentum, not muscle.
- Progression. Members who cannot yet perform a repetition should work with assistance, with slower lowering phases, or with a reduced range before adding load. Members who find the movement easy add load with a weight belt.
Standards, indoor and outdoor
This is where specification most often goes wrong. An indoor power tower is indoor stationary training equipment and falls under EN ISO 20957-1, class S. An outdoor unit installed in a public space, a campsite, a residential development or a municipal fitness area is a different product covered by EN 16630, the standard for permanently installed outdoor fitness equipment. The two are not interchangeable, and an indoor frame placed outside is neither compliant nor durable.

Specifying and siting the station
- Stability and anchoring. A frame that a member hangs from and swings on has to be either heavy enough or anchored. Follow the manufacturer’s instruction for the model, and never assume that floor weight alone is enough.
- Ceiling height. A tall member pulling up on a tall frame needs headroom above the bar. Measure before you order; this is the constraint that eliminates otherwise suitable models.
- Clear space around it. Users swing, drop off the bar and step back from dips. Allow the working envelope, not the base area.
- Grip options. Multiple grip widths and a neutral grip position widen the range of members who can use the station comfortably.
- Floor beneath. A member dropping off a pull-up bar lands with force. Specify the flooring accordingly.
Frequently asked questions
Which muscles does a power tower train?
Back and biceps through pull-ups, triceps and chest through dips, the abdominal wall through leg raises, and horizontal pressing through push-up variations. It covers a large part of upper-body training on one frame.
Is a power tower suitable for a small facility?
It is one of the best purchases a small facility can make. The footprint is small, no weight stack is required, and it covers movements that a compact selectorised set-up cannot.
Can an indoor model be installed outdoors?
No. Outdoor installation requires equipment built and certified for it under EN 16630, in a corrosion-resistant construction. An indoor frame outdoors is a safety and durability problem.
How do members progress if there is no weight stack?
Through assistance and reduced range at the start, then repetitions and controlled tempo, then added load with a weight belt. The absence of a stack is not a limit on progression, only a change in how it is managed.
